World Regional Geography

A survey of the entire world that uses the regional approach to geographical analysis, this course provides students with a basic foundation of geographic knowledge and concepts applicable to the contemporary world. It stresses resource distribution, environmental characteristics, population problems, food and water supplies, cultural variations and developmental strategies.
